Ebola virus unleashed on crowds at Disneyland . . . plastic explosives hidden in 747s . . . random car bombings on interstate highways--tense, thrilling, and as real as today's headlines, "Freedom to Kill" presents an authentic novel of suspense by a former FBI agent. Facing a madman dubbed the "Cataclysmist", FBI agent Mike Devlin races against time to break a case that threatens the security of the whole country.
